Topics Covered
- 1. Introduction to Cryptography: Learners will study the basic principles of cryptography, including symmetric and asymmetric encryption, hash functions, and key management. They will gain foundational knowledge to understand the core concepts and terminology used in cryptographic systems.
- 2. Cryptographic Protocols: This module covers various cryptographic protocols such as SSL/TLS, SSH, and IPsec, focusing on their secure implementation and verification methods. Learners will understand how these protocols secure data transmission and learn to analyze their security properties.
- 3. Cryptographic Attacks: Learners will explore common cryptographic attacks, including brute force, side-channel, and man-in-the-middle attacks. They will learn how to identify vulnerabilities and develop strategies to mitigate these risks.
- 4. Hash Functions and Message Authentication Codes (MACs): This module delves into the design and verification of hash functions and MACs. Learners will study the principles of secure hash functions and MACs, and practice techniques for verifying their security properties.
- 5. Public Key Infrastructure (PKI): Learners will study the principles and implementation of PKI, including certificate authorities, digital certificates, and key revocation mechanisms. They will gain practical skills in setting up and managing a PKI system.
- 6. Symmetric Key Cryptography: This module covers the design and analysis of symmetric key algorithms, including block ciphers and stream ciphers. Learners will learn how to apply these algorithms in secure systems and how to verify their security.
- 7. Asymmetric Key Cryptography: Learners will study the principles of public key cryptography, focusing on algorithms like RSA and ECC. They will learn how to generate, manage, and verify public and private keys.
- 8. Zero-Knowledge Proofs: This module introduces the concept of zero-knowledge proofs and their applications in cryptographic systems. Learners will understand how to construct and verify zero-knowledge proofs and their role in privacy-preserving protocols.
- 9. Cryptographic Verification Techniques: Learners will explore various techniques for verifying the security of cryptographic algorithms and protocols, including formal verification and fuzz testing. They will gain practical skills in applying these techniques to ensure the robustness of cryptographic systems.
- 10. Practical Applications of Cryptographic Verification: This final module focuses on real-world applications of cryptographic verification methods. Learners will work on practical projects to apply their knowledge and skills in verifying the security of cryptographic systems in various domains such as finance, healthcare, and cybersecurity.
